Two related fixes land together because the UI was reporting
"1 accepted 1 rejected" for every 999 even though every inbound file
Gainwell ships has IK5=A.
1. Gainwell's MFT uses IK5 where the X12 005010X231A1 spec calls
for AK5 (the per-set accept/reject segment). The parser only
recognized AK5, so set_responses[0].set_accept_reject.code
defaulted to 'R' and the count summary showed all rejections.
_consume_ak2 now accepts either AK5 or IK5; the orchestrator's
segment-skip set picks up IK5 too. A new fixture
(minimal_999_ik5_gainwell.txt) is a verbatim copy of one of the
files in the FromHPE inbound staging dir.
2. _ack_count_summary (api + scheduler) now trusts the per-set
IK5 codes over the functional-group AK9. Gainwell's AK9 is
internally inconsistent — the per-claim IK5=A but the AK9
reports accepted=1, rejected=1, received=1 (sum exceeds
received). Trusting the per-set codes restores the right
answer: accepted=1, rejected=0, code='A'.
3. The Acks page now has a TA1 envelope register alongside the
999 register. TA1s are the lower-level sibling of the 999
(one row per inbound ISA/IEA). The backend surface (parser,
store, API at /api/ta1-acks) was already in place; this
adds the UI: Ta1Ack type, listTa1Acks API method, useTa1Acks
hook, and a Ta1AcksSection card with KPIs + table.
After reprocessing 1056 cached 999s through the new code: every row
shows code='A' with accepted=1, rejected=0 — matches the Gainwell
portal's per-claim accepted state. The user's earlier observation
("the claims look to be accepted in the portal") was correct: the
underlying claim state was always fine, only the displayed count was
wrong.

Gainwell's MFT ships every 999 with the same ISA interchange
control number (`000000001`) and one 999 ack covers a whole
batch, not a single claim — so the AK2 set_control_number
(patient_control_number) is the same for the ~96 999s in a
batch. With the old synthetic-id formula (`999-{icn}`), all 385
daily acks collapsed onto a single row the operator couldn't
distinguish.
The new formula is `999-{pcn}-{filename_hash8}` (or
`999-{icn}-{filename_hash8}` for envelope-only 999s without an
AK2). The PCN gives the operator a human-readable handle to the
claim batch; the 8-char hash of the inbound filename guarantees
uniqueness within a batch. Fits in the VARCHAR(32) source_batch_id
column (max 22 chars).
Also surface `patient_control_number` in /api/acks list response
(extracted from raw_json's set_responses[0].set_control_number)
and in the Acks UI as the primary label, with the synthetic id
shown dimmed after a middle dot. The detail endpoint already
exposed raw_json for the full 999 parse tree.

The live-tail stream (now reachable through the new Vite /api proxy)
started delivering activity rows with kind="manual_match", a kind the
ActivityFeed kindConfig map didn't know about. The map lookup returned
undefined, and reading .icon on it threw — taking the whole Activity
Log page down.
Two fixes:
1. Add "manual_match" to the ActivityKind union in src/types/index.ts
and to the kindConfig map in src/components/ActivityFeed.tsx (with
a Wrench icon + neutral tone), so the kind is properly typed and
rendered.
2. Add a FALLBACK_KIND guard so any future backend-emitted kind that
arrives before the frontend is updated no longer crashes the page.
kindConfig stays exhaustive for known kinds, so TypeScript still
catches missing entries at compile time.
Also adds src/components/ActivityFeed.test.tsx with three regression
tests (empty state, multi-item render, unknown-kind safety).
The Reconciliation page crashed with 'c.chargeAmount.toFixed is undefined' because
the TS types declared fields the backend never emitted (chargeAmount vs billedAmount,
patientControlNumber vs patientName, statusCode vs status, totalPaid vs paidAmount).
- UnmatchedClaim: chargeAmount -> billedAmount, patientControlNumber -> patientName,
payerId/serviceDate now optional (backend omits them)
- UnmatchedRemittance: statusCode -> status, totalPaid -> paidAmount,
totalCharge/serviceDate/isReversal now optional
- Reconciliation page + test fixtures updated to use the wire shape
